How does a guess-the-idol quiz work?
The image quiz format is simple: each question shows a photo and four possible answers. You pick who it is. Some quizzes test individual idols, others test which group a member belongs to, and the hardest ones use pre-debut, concept or throwback photos where the visual is less obvious.
Why is guessing K-pop idols harder than it looks?
Concepts change everything. K-pop idols transform their hair, styling and makeup dramatically between eras, so the same person can look completely different from one comeback to the next. Group members also share styling during a concept, which makes telling them apart a real test even for longtime fans.
Tip: look past the hair color. Facial features and proportions stay constant across eras, so train yourself to anchor on those instead of the styling.
How can I get better at visual K-pop quizzes?
Start with groups you already follow, then branch out one group at a time. Learn each member alongside their most distinctive era, and use member quizzes to lock in names before you attempt photo-only rounds. Repetition is what turns a lucky guess into instant recognition.
